Subject: [32/49] udf: Fix deadlock when converting file from in-ICB one to normal one

During BKL removal in 2.6.38, conversion of files from in-ICB format to normal
format got broken. We call ->writepage with i_data_sem held but udf_get_block()
also acquires i_data_sem thus creating A-A deadlock.

We fix the problem by dropping i_data_sem before calling ->writepage() which is
safe since i_mutex still protects us against any changes in the file. Also fix
pagelock - i_data_sem lock inversion in udf_expand_file_adinicb() by dropping
i_data_sem before calling find_or_create_page().

---
 fs/udf/file.c  |    6 +++---
 fs/udf/inode.c |   21 ++++++++++++++++++---
 2 files changed, 21 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)

--- a/fs/udf/file.c
+++ b/fs/udf/file.c
@@ -125,7 +125,6 @@ static ssize_t udf_file_aio_write(struct
 			err = udf_expand_file_adinicb(inode);
 			if (err) {
 				udf_debug("udf_expand_adinicb: err=%d\n", err);
-				up_write(&iinfo->i_data_sem);
 				return err;
 			}
 		} else {
@@ -133,9 +132,10 @@ static ssize_t udf_file_aio_write(struct
 				iinfo->i_lenAlloc = pos + count;
 			else
 				iinfo->i_lenAlloc = inode->i_size;
+			up_write(&iinfo->i_data_sem);
 		}
-	}
-	up_write(&iinfo->i_data_sem);
+	} else
+		up_write(&iinfo->i_data_sem);
 
 	retval = generic_file_aio_write(iocb, iov, nr_segs, ppos);
 	if (retval > 0)
--- a/fs/udf/inode.c
+++ b/fs/udf/inode.c
@@ -151,6 +151,12 @@ const struct address_space_operations ud
 	.bmap		= udf_bmap,
 };
 
+/*
+ * Expand file stored in ICB to a normal one-block-file
+ *
+ * This function requires i_data_sem for writing and releases it.
+ * This function requires i_mutex held
+ */
 int udf_expand_file_adinicb(struct inode *inode)
 {
 	struct page *page;
@@ -169,9 +175,15 @@ int udf_expand_file_adinicb(struct inode
 			iinfo->i_alloc_type = ICBTAG_FLAG_AD_LONG;
 		/* from now on we have normal address_space methods */
 		inode->i_data.a_ops = &udf_aops;
+		up_write(&iinfo->i_data_sem);
 		mark_inode_dirty(inode);
 		return 0;
 	}
+	/*
+	 * Release i_data_sem so that we can lock a page - page lock ranks
+	 * above i_data_sem. i_mutex still protects us against file changes.
+	 */
+	up_write(&iinfo->i_data_sem);
 
 	page = find_or_create_page(inode->i_mapping, 0, GFP_NOFS);
 	if (!page)
@@ -187,6 +199,7 @@ int udf_expand_file_adinicb(struct inode
 		SetPageUptodate(page);
 		kunmap(page);
 	}
+	down_write(&iinfo->i_data_sem);
 	memset(iinfo->i_ext.i_data + iinfo->i_lenEAttr, 0x00,
 	       iinfo->i_lenAlloc);
 	iinfo->i_lenAlloc = 0;
@@ -196,17 +209,20 @@ int udf_expand_file_adinicb(struct inode
 		iinfo->i_alloc_type = ICBTAG_FLAG_AD_LONG;
 	/* from now on we have normal address_space methods */
 	inode->i_data.a_ops = &udf_aops;
+	up_write(&iinfo->i_data_sem);
 	err = inode->i_data.a_ops->writepage(page, &udf_wbc);
 	if (err) {
 		/* Restore everything back so that we don't lose data... */
 		lock_page(page);
 		kaddr = kmap(page);
+		down_write(&iinfo->i_data_sem);
 		memcpy(iinfo->i_ext.i_data + iinfo->i_lenEAttr, kaddr,
 		       inode->i_size);
 		kunmap(page);
 		unlock_page(page);
 		iinfo->i_alloc_type = ICBTAG_FLAG_AD_IN_ICB;
 		inode->i_data.a_ops = &udf_adinicb_aops;
+		up_write(&iinfo->i_data_sem);
 	}
 	page_cache_release(page);
 	mark_inode_dirty(inode);
@@ -1111,10 +1127,9 @@ int udf_setsize(struct inode *inode, lof
 			if (bsize <
 			    (udf_file_entry_alloc_offset(inode) + newsize)) {
 				err = udf_expand_file_adinicb(inode);
-				if (err) {
-					up_write(&iinfo->i_data_sem);
+				if (err)
 					return err;
-				}
+				down_write(&iinfo->i_data_sem);
 			} else
 				iinfo->i_lenAlloc = newsize;
 		}
